UK Payroll Giving Week
Payroll Giving Week happens once a year when charities, payroll giving agencies, payroll funding organisations and companies make a special effort to increase the awareness of Payroll Giving. So what is Payroll Giving? RSPCA South London branch are responsible for animal welfare in much of the capital south of the river including Anerley, Balham, Croydon, Crystal Palace, Gipsy Hill, Mitcham, Norwood, Sydenham, Thornton Heath, Tooting, Wallington & Wandsworth.
